What counts as exercise on an Apple Watch is based on an individual’s personal health data. When tracking exercise minutes, the Apple Watch will closely monitor your heart rate. Having a faster heart rate for an entire minute will count toward your exercise. east club bischofswerda

WebSep 6, 2024 · Apple defines exercise as anything equivalent to a brisk walk or more that raises your heart rate consistently. Apple monitors your heart rate and your movement … WebOct 5, 2024 · With up to date personal information, your Apple Watch calculates your body’s Basal Metabolic Rate (BMR). This calculates the average calories burned per day. It then adds the active calories from exercise to give you an accurate estimate of the total calories you burn during the day.

Turn this off. cube in pythonWebVO2max—the maximum amount of oxygen your body can consume during exercise— is a strong predictor of overall health. Clinical tests measure VO2max by having the patient exercise on a treadmill or bike, with an intensity that increases every few minutes until exhaustion.
